AUBUSSON - EARLY 18th CENTURY
Fragment of Aubusson low-slung greenery in wool and silk, in a wooded landscape, a duck and two ducks are swimming in a body of water. On the bank, a dog barks, but the duck protects the two ducks. In the background, a balustraded footbridge spans the water, behind it stand buildings, and in the distance you can make out the relief. In the trees two birds are perched
Size: 201,5 x 206 cm. 79 1/4 x 81 in.
Lined, good general condition, visible restorations (sewn parts), discolorations
